Transaction ff789c4d61d1bc605ad97c535a5dae73e2a8524c70aacfbc9971e159cc0f14f1

1 Input
2 Outputs
  • ff789c4d61d1bc605ad97c535a5dae73e2a8524c70aacfbc9971e159cc0f14f1:0
  • value  7594560467
    address  2N9mZJ5gx8fnqUsmw8N4wdiUh2vsp5CtCmg
  • ff789c4d61d1bc605ad97c535a5dae73e2a8524c70aacfbc9971e159cc0f14f1:1
  • value  1489758
    address  2Mt68iEg9UjoRqjeLZjwJPugQ1MbEeBh9do